summaryrefslogtreecommitdiff
path: root/docs/docbook/Makefile.in
diff options
context:
space:
mode:
Diffstat (limited to 'docs/docbook/Makefile.in')
-rw-r--r--docs/docbook/Makefile.in58
1 files changed, 21 insertions, 37 deletions
diff --git a/docs/docbook/Makefile.in b/docs/docbook/Makefile.in
index ce3d009f6c..132b5de978 100644
--- a/docs/docbook/Makefile.in
+++ b/docs/docbook/Makefile.in
@@ -21,9 +21,7 @@ MANPAGES_NAMES=findsmb.1 smbclient.1 \
smbpasswd.8 testprns.1 \
smb.conf.5 wbinfo.1 pdbedit.8 \
smbcacls.1 smbsh.1 winbindd.8 \
- vfstest.1 \
- profiles.1 smbtree.1 ntlm_auth.1 \
- editreg.1 smbcquotas.1
+ vfstest.1
## This part contains only rules. You shouldn't need to change it
## if you are adding docs
@@ -68,42 +66,36 @@ everything: manpages ps pdf html-single html htmlman txt htmlfaq
# Global rules
-manpages: $(MANDIR) $(MANPAGES)
-pdf: $(PDFDIR) $(PDFDIR)/Samba-HOWTO-Collection.pdf ../Samba-Developers-Guide.pdf
-ps: $(PSDIR) $(PSDIR)/Samba-HOWTO-Collection.ps ../Samba-Developers-Guide.ps
-txt: $(TXTDIR) $(TXTDIR)/Samba-HOWTO-Collection.txt $(TXTDIR)/Samba-Developers-Guide.txt
-htmlman: $(HTMLDIR) $(MANPAGES_HTML)
-htmlfaq: $(HTMLDIR)
+manpages: $(MANPAGES)
+pdf: $(PDFDIR)/Samba-HOWTO-Collection.pdf ../Samba-Developers-Guide.pdf
+ps: $(PSDIR)/Samba-HOWTO-Collection.ps ../Samba-Developers-Guide.ps
+txt: $(TXTDIR)/Samba-HOWTO-Collection.txt $(TXTDIR)/Samba-Developers-Guide.txt
+htmlman: $(MANPAGES_HTML)
+htmlfaq:
$(DOCBOOK2HTML) -d samba.dsl -o $(FAQDIR) $(FAQPROJDOC)/sambafaq.sgml
-html-single: $(HTMLDIR) $(HTMLDIR)/Samba-HOWTO-Collection.html $(HTMLDIR)/Samba-Developers-Guide.html
-html: $(HTMLDIR)
+html-single: $(HTMLDIR)/Samba-HOWTO-Collection.html $(HTMLDIR)/Samba-Developers-Guide.html
+html:
$(DOCBOOK2HTML) -d samba.dsl -o $(HTMLDIR) $(PROJDOC)/samba-doc.sgml
# Text files
-$(TXTDIR):
- mkdir $(TXTDIR)
-
$(TXTDIR)/Samba-HOWTO-Collection.txt: $(PROJDOC)/samba-doc.sgml
- $(DOCBOOK2TXT) -d samba.dsl -o . $<
+ $(DOCBOOK2TXT) -o . $<
mv ./samba-doc.txt $@
-$(TXTDIR)/Samba-Developers-Guide.txt: $(DEVDOC)/dev-doc.sgml
- $(DOCBOOK2TXT) -d samba.dsl -o . $<
- mv ./dev-doc.txt $@
+$(TXTDIR)/Samba-Developers-Guide.txt: $(PROJDOC)/samba-doc.sgml
+ $(DOCBOOK2TXT) -o . $<
+ mv ./samba-doc.txt $@
# PostScript
-$(PSDIR):
- mkdir $(PSDIR)
-
$(PSDIR)/Samba-HOWTO-Collection.ps: $(PROJDOC)/samba-doc.sgml
- $(DOCBOOK2PS) -d samba.dsl -o . $<
+ $(DOCBOOK2PS) -o . $<
mv ./samba-doc.ps $@
-$(PSDIR)/Samba-Developers-Guide.ps: $(DEVDOC)/dev-doc.sgml
- $(DOCBOOK2PS) -d samba.dsl -o . $<
- mv ./dev-doc.ps $@
+$(PSDIR)/Samba-Developers-Guide.ps: $(PROJDOC)/samba-doc.sgml
+ $(DOCBOOK2PS) -o . $<
+ mv ./samba-doc.ps $@
# Adobe PDF files
@@ -115,28 +107,20 @@ $(PDFDIR)/Samba-Developers-Guide.pdf: $(HTMLDIR)/Samba-Developers-Guide.html
# Single large HTML files
-$(HTMLDIR):
- mkdir $(HTMLDIR)
-
$(HTMLDIR)/Samba-HOWTO-Collection.html: $(PROJDOC)/samba-doc.sgml
- $(DOCBOOK2HTML) -d samba.dsl -u -o . $<
+ $(DOCBOOK2HTML) -u -o . $<
mv ./samba-doc.html $@
$(HTMLDIR)/Samba-Developers-Guide.html: $(DEVDOC)/dev-doc.sgml
- $(DOCBOOK2HTML) -d samba.dsl -u -o . $<
+ $(DOCBOOK2HTML) -u -o . $<
mv ./dev-doc.html $@
$(HTMLDIR)/%.html: $(MANPROJDOC)/%.sgml
- $(DOCBOOK2HTML) -d samba.dsl -u -o $(HTMLDIR) $<
-
-# Manpages
-
-$(MANDIR):
- mkdir $(MANDIR)
+ $(DOCBOOK2HTML) -u -o $(HTMLDIR) $<
$(MANDIR)/%: $(MANPROJDOC)/%.sgml
- $(DOCBOOK2MAN) -d samba.dsl -o $(MANDIR) $<
+ $(DOCBOOK2MAN) -o $(MANDIR) $< || rm $@
$(PERL) scripts/strip-links.pl < $@ > $@.temp
mv $@.temp $@